HTML中可以使用PHP引用PHP中的變量的值,這樣可以使得網頁的內容更具動態性和實時性。假設我們有一個名為"username"的變量,其中存儲了用戶的用戶名。我們可以通過在HTML中嵌入PHP代碼來引用這個變量的值,并將其展示在網頁上。
在PHP中,我們可以這樣定義變量:
$username = "John";
然后,在HTML中使用PHP引用這個變量的值:
歡迎登錄!
上述代碼將在網頁上顯示出"歡迎 John 登錄!"。這樣,無論$username變量的值是什么,我們都能動態地展示用戶的用戶名。
我們還可以通過引用PHP中的變量來控制網頁上的內容。比如,假設我們需要根據用戶的角色動態顯示不同的導航欄。在PHP中,我們可以定義一個名為"role"的變量,并根據用戶的角色來設定變量的值。然后,在HTML中根據這個變量的值來顯示不同的導航欄。
$role = "admin";
- 首頁
- 用戶管理
- 文章管理
- 首頁
- 個人資料
- 文章列表
上述代碼將根據$role變量的值顯示不同的導航欄。如果$role的值是"admin",將顯示包含"用戶管理"和"文章管理"鏈接的導航欄;如果$role的值不是"admin",將顯示包含"個人資料"和"文章列表"鏈接的導航欄。
除了引用變量的值外,我們還可以在HTML代碼中使用PHP的其他功能,如循環和條件語句。這樣,我們可以根據不同的條件來動態地生成網頁的內容。下面是一個示例,展示如何根據數組中的數據動態生成列表:
$fruits = array("蘋果", "香蕉", "橙子", "西瓜");
上述代碼將根據$fruits數組中的數據動態生成一個水果列表。無論$fruits數組中有多少個元素,都能通過循環來展示出來。
通過在HTML中引用PHP中的變量,我們可以實現網頁內容的動態展示和控制。無論是顯示用戶信息、生成不同的導航欄還是根據數據生成列表,都可以通過PHP的強大功能來實現。這樣,我們能夠為用戶提供更具個性化的網頁體驗。